    Bolivian President Rodrigo Paz has eliminated Financial Minister Jose Gabriel Espinoza from his submit after the minister was censured by the nation’s Congress.

    The cupboard shake-up is prone to be perceived as a concession by Paz, who has confronted public anger in regards to the nation’s ongoing cost-of-living crisis.

    The announcement got here in a decree revealed on Friday within the authorities’s official gazette.

    It names Oscar Mario Justiniano Pinto as interim financial system minister and explains he’ll serve within the function till a everlasting candidate is appointed. The decree doesn’t, nonetheless, provide a potential timeline for the eventual substitute.

    The choice to fireside Espinoza, nonetheless, marks a reversal for the Paz authorities.

    On Tuesday, the Bolivian Congress voted to censure Espinoza, after he failed to seem earlier than the legislature to reply questions in regards to the financial system. Below the nation’s structure, a censure tees up a subsequent dismissal.

    The proper-wing Paz administration initially mentioned it could battle that call as a tribunal reviewed the dispute. However Friday’s decree suggests the president modified course.

    Bolivia has been roiled by financial and political turmoil for years. Paz, a senator on the time, was elected final October after pledging to deliver stability again to the South American nation.

    His inauguration the next month marked an finish to just about 20 years of governance by the Motion Towards Socialism (MAS). Paz, against this, ran on a marketing campaign of “capitalism for all”.

    His victory was fuelled by considerations about Bolivia’s financial situations. As soon as a serious exporter of gas, the nation had seen a decline in its pure gasoline manufacturing, with mismanagement, depleted reserves and a scarcity of recent exploration cited among the many causes.

    With a shortfall in exterior income, Bolivia additionally suffered a decline in its reserves of international foreign money, resulting in additional instability.

    However Paz has struggled to handle Bolivia’s ailing financial system whereas balancing home wants. As of 2024, greater than 37 p.c of the inhabitants fell under the nationwide poverty line.

    Final December, Paz’s authorities nixed longstanding gas subsidies, prompting protest.

    A land reform coverage signed in April likewise spurred an outburst of public unrest, with rural and Indigenous voters fearing it could weaken protections for small-property homeowners.

    Paz finally reversed course on the coverage the next month, however all through a lot of Might and June, the nation was gripped by roadblocks, marches and different public demonstrations, with some protesters calling for Paz’s resignation.

    The president declared a state of emergency in June, and the nation’s Congress approved the use of the military to clear the blockages.

    The choice to fireside Espinoza comes at a key juncture for the Paz administration.

    Paz is at present looking for congressional help for a collection of financial reforms, together with a financing programme from the Worldwide Financial Fund (IMF).

    Information of Espinoza’s departure was greeted as an indication of cooperation with Congress. By means of the choice, Paz was “displaying a measure of humility and complying with the Structure”, based on opposition lawmaker Roland Pacheco.

    However Paz’s authorities continues to face home backlash. Supporters of former President Evo Morales proceed to oppose the brand new administration, and the left-wing chief continues to play an outsized function within the nation’s politics.

    Morales has inspired resistance to Paz’s austerity measures. A courtroom in Bolivia issued an arrest warrant for the ex-leader in July, accusing him of encouraging his supporters to participate in an “armed rebellion” in June. He additionally faces a separate warrant for statutory rape.

    In a social media submit, Morales accused the federal government of persecuting him “to hide the true drama Bolivia is experiencing: a deep financial and social disaster … a mannequin that has deserted the folks and protects corruption”.
